May presented us with an unintended two-week break from the blog. While we were planning our trip to Texas, I had scheduled ahead as much as I could and took my old laptop to fill in spots I normally posted. Last time I used the laptop, it was extremely slow, huffing and puffing, sounding like it was preparing for take-off. I guess it did as I was not able to get into the administration of the blog.

Luckenbach TXWe met up with our old Navy buddies of 54 years, first in Hot Springs, Arkansas, then to their home in the upper eastern part of Texas, portions known as “the Hill country.” OMG, so beautiful! Not the Texas of my memory at all. Green hills, monster oaks hundreds of years old, wildflowers everywhere. And so much to see and do! Fantastic hosts, Ted and Kitra packed in a full schedule and we enjoyed great food and in Luckenbach, a downhome country band. So much fun!  (We missed Waylon and Willie though.)

With the crash of a laptop used only for out-of-town trips now, I began a search for a cheap replacement, and after seeing Kitra’s Kindle Fire (she also reads—a LOT) and the extent of its capabilities, I began thinking in terms of a tablet. During our motorcycling years, we learned to travel with just a trunk and saddlebags that fit on the back of the bikes. We have traditionally traveled light. I needed something light.

I looked at laptops, the size, and the price. Goodness! Then the tablets: I liked the size, the weight, and the price. However, they just won’t do Photoshop—hoping I can get by with Canva. Also, having old equipment and old versions of Word—which I paid for years ago and have managed to use in successive PC’s, have now discovered it’s subscription only—except for those tablets 10.1” and below.

It’s been a bear figuring out how to get the tablet, an Android (Samsung) set up to my liking. I need a class for this! I finally figured out how to get Office Word on it. But it won’t open a document without asking for an upgrade to Office 365—the subscription. Has anyone tried to download and use a free version of Word on a tablet?
